  1. #1
    I have launched 2 websites (www.developertoolz.com and www.developernewz.com) 3 weeks ago, I am averaging about 10 uniques a day and I think the site could be doing a lot better than that.
    Could someone review the sites and tell me how i can improve its SEO?

    thank you

    the sites looks good, ok heres what i think, from what i saw on the page its all dynamic you should add static text content and add some images and put alt tags on those images... and you must target a specific keyword on your site and use an appropriate meta tags for title and description...

    Big thing is title tags for you right now.

    Also dont expect traffic in 3 weeks in that niche. It will take a long time and your gonna need a ton of incoming links.

    mod_rewrite the URLs if you can. Not very important but it helps.

    build tons of incoming links. Directory submission, article writing, ect.

    keep making a ton of unique content.
